I bought a 1960 356B Normal (60 hp) back in 1972 for...are you ready for it...$500 and it was the same colour as this one, only with red upholstery. As I'd been weaned on VWs I took quite naturally to the 356, as it drove like a faster, flatter-cornering beetle. Top speed (indicated) was 103 mph, driving in the red band, but it was so nimble you could drive it almost flat out anywhere. Going back to college I had to sell it to raise some funds and I still regret it to this day. I got to drive a Super 90 once and that was really, really nice and I always hoped to acquire one some day but now that the prices have gone through the stratosphere I know I'll never own one again. But I still think back to the great times I had with that car and list it as one of my favorites of all time.

Red/orange tails were european 356s only. North American cars were all-red due to US regs. It's a little weird, because the orange is also your brake light. Some cars in Europe had a slightly different arrangement where the inner lights were the tail/brake lights and the outers were blinker only (Italy I think). If you see a car in the US with red/orange it's either an import or a euro delivery car.
